TUESDAY MORNING CORPORATION

 

ANNOUNCES FIRST QUARTER FISCAL 2009 RESULTS

 

DALLAS, TX – October 28, 2008 — Tuesday Morning Corporation (NASDAQ: TUES) today reported that as previously announced, net sales for the first quarter of fiscal 2009 were $173.4 million compared to $201.7 million for the quarter ended September 30, 2007, a decrease of 14.0%.  Comparable store sales decreased 17.3% for the quarter.  The decrease in comparable store sales was comprised of a 14.0% decrease in traffic and a 3.3% decrease in average ticket.  Net loss for the first quarter ended September 30, 2008 was $4.3 million or ($0.10) per diluted share, compared to net income of $1.2 million or $0.03 per diluted share for the same period last year.

 

Kathleen Mason, President and Chief Executive Officer, stated, “Disposable income continues to be pressured by tight credit, food and fuel inflation, declining home values, and losses in investment accounts. Consumers are cutting back non-essential purchases.  Also, Tuesday Morning stores were impacted by the effects of two hurricanes that reduced sales by approximately $4.2 million and earnings per share by approximately $.02 during the quarter.  Despite these pressures, we controlled inventory and expenses to partially offset the decline in demand.  We remain focused on achieving annual profits and maintaining our strong balance sheet.”

 

Guidance for the fiscal year ending on June 30, 2009 is as follows:

 

·                  net sales are projected to be in the range of $854 million to $859 million;

·                  comparable store sales are projected to be in the negative mid single digits; and

·                  diluted earnings per share projected to be in the range of $0.19 to $0.21.

About Tuesday Morning

 

Tuesday Morning is a leading closeout retailer of upscale, decorative home accessories, housewares and famous-maker gifts in the United States. The Company opened its first store in 1974 and currently operates 851 stores in 45 states. Tuesday Morning is nationally known for bringing its more than 9.0 million loyal customers a unique treasure hunt of high-end, first quality, brand name merchandise...never seconds or irregulars...at prices well below those of department and specialty stores and catalogues.
